Understanding Bookkeeping Basics
Bookkeeping involves recording every financial transaction your business makes. Each entry reflects money going in or out. It includes sales, expenses, payroll, and more. Keeping these records helps you see your business’s financial health at any time. Bookkeeping can be manual or digital. Both methods require accuracy and regular updates to prevent errors.

Comparing Manual and Digital Bookkeeping
| Aspect | Manual Bookkeeping | Digital Bookkeeping |
| Cost | Lower initial cost | May require software investment |
| Accuracy | Prone to human error | Reduced errors with automation |
| Time | Time-consuming | Faster with automated processes |

Tips for Effective Bookkeeping
To keep your books in order, consider these tips:
- Separate Business and Personal Finances: Use different accounts to avoid confusion.
- Regular Updates: Schedule time weekly to update your books.
- Use Technology: Consider bookkeeping software for efficiency.
